LiteFX 0.3.1.2022
Computer Graphics Engine
LiteFX::Rendering::Backends::VulkanFrameBuffer Member List

This is the complete list of members for LiteFX::Rendering::Backends::VulkanFrameBuffer, including all inherited members.

bufferIndex() const noexcept overrideLiteFX::Rendering::Backends::VulkanFrameBuffervirtual
command_buffer_type typedefLiteFX::Rendering::FrameBuffer< VulkanCommandBuffer >
commandBuffer(const UInt32 &index) const overrideLiteFX::Rendering::Backends::VulkanFrameBuffervirtual
commandBuffers() const noexcept overrideLiteFX::Rendering::Backends::VulkanFrameBuffervirtual
getHeight() const noexcept overrideLiteFX::Rendering::Backends::VulkanFrameBuffervirtual
getWidth() const noexcept overrideLiteFX::Rendering::Backends::VulkanFrameBuffervirtual
handle() noexcept overrideLiteFX::Resource< VkFramebuffer >inlineprotectedvirtual
handle() const noexcept overrideLiteFX::Resource< VkFramebuffer >inlinevirtual
image(const UInt32 &location) const overrideLiteFX::Rendering::Backends::VulkanFrameBuffervirtual
image_type typedefLiteFX::Rendering::FrameBuffer< VulkanCommandBuffer >
images() const noexcept overrideLiteFX::Rendering::Backends::VulkanFrameBuffervirtual
lastFence() const noexceptLiteFX::Rendering::Backends::VulkanFrameBuffervirtual
resize(const Size2d &renderArea) overrideLiteFX::Rendering::Backends::VulkanFrameBuffervirtual
Resource(const VkFramebuffer handle) noexceptLiteFX::Resource< VkFramebuffer >inlineexplicitprotected
Resource(const Resource &)=deleteLiteFX::Resource< VkFramebuffer >
Resource(Resource &&)=deleteLiteFX::Resource< VkFramebuffer >
semaphore() const noexceptLiteFX::Rendering::Backends::VulkanFrameBuffervirtual
size() const noexcept overrideLiteFX::Rendering::Backends::VulkanFrameBuffervirtual
VulkanFrameBuffer(const VulkanRenderPass &renderPass, const UInt32 &bufferIndex, const Size2d &renderArea, const UInt32 &commandBuffers=1)LiteFX::Rendering::Backends::VulkanFrameBuffer
VulkanFrameBuffer(const VulkanFrameBuffer &) noexcept=deleteLiteFX::Rendering::Backends::VulkanFrameBuffer
VulkanFrameBuffer(VulkanFrameBuffer &&) noexcept=deleteLiteFX::Rendering::Backends::VulkanFrameBuffer
~FrameBuffer() noexcept=defaultLiteFX::Rendering::FrameBuffer< VulkanCommandBuffer >virtual
~IFrameBuffer() noexcept=defaultLiteFX::Rendering::IFrameBuffervirtual
~IResource() noexcept=defaultLiteFX::IResource< VkFramebuffer >virtual
~Resource() noexcept=defaultLiteFX::Resource< VkFramebuffer >virtual
~VulkanFrameBuffer() noexceptLiteFX::Rendering::Backends::VulkanFrameBuffervirtual